Watch The World's Most Beautiful Landscapes Season 1 Episode 8: The Amazon HD for free on Banana HD

Cinema Mode
The World's Most Beautiful Landscapes

The World's Most Beautiful Landscapes

Take a magnificent visual tour of some of the most breathtaking and extraordinary landscapes in the world to marvel at the wonders and learn about the fauna, geology, and the rich history of its people.
Genres:
Production:
Country:
Duration:
47 m

Discussion